the quality of being natural or based on natural principles
<noun.attribute> he accepted the naturalness of death the spontaneous naturalness of his manner
the quality of innocent naivete
<noun.attribute>
the likeness of a representation to the thing represented
<noun.attribute> engineers strove to increase the naturalness of recorded music
Naturalness \Nat"u*ral*ness\, n. The state or quality of being natural; conformity to nature.
